Fundamentally however a >> loop has width and height 2 dimensions not one. > >Take a strip of paper, twist it 180 degrees and then join the ends. You >end up with a 3 dimensional object which has only one 2d side. You can >prove that to yourself by drawing a line along the surface - it'll make >two revolutions, passing across the entire surface before getting back >to the starting point. > >That's the 3d/2d version of a general type of shape. A Klein bottle is >the 4d/3d version, which can only be approximated in 3 dimensions.
